Vegetation Intrusion in Drains

Invasive tree roots naturally seek moisture, making cracked or jointed pipes an easy target for root infiltration. Once inside, roots expand and cause pressure, worsening leaks and leading to costly repairs. Melbourne’s leafy suburbs often face this issue due to mature landscaping.

Video Inspection for Sewer Faults

Sewer line inspection is the gold standard for diagnosing hidden pipe problems. A small camera is fed through the pipe, providing real-time footage of cracks, root intrusions, or corrosion. This no-dig method eliminates guesswork.

Whether for commercial drain detection, this technique allows for accurate diagnosis and targeted repairs. It’s essential for planning pipe relining without unnecessary excavation.

Acoustic Water Loss Tracing

Acoustic leak tracing can locate underground leaks by detecting the sound of water escaping under pressure. This highly effective method is ideal for garden areas where digging isn’t an option.

Thermal Scanning for Hidden Leaks

Infrared scanning reveals temperature differences caused by water escaping behind walls or under floors. This cutting-edge technology allows plumbers to visualise moisture without drilling or demolition. It’s perfect for non-invasive inspection

Hydrostatic Inspection for Pipe Lines

Hydrostatic testing involves sealing and pressurising a sewer line to check for leaks. If pressure drops, it indicates a breach that needs repair. This conclusive test is often used before or after major renovations.

Average Fee for Camera Inspection

A drain camera inspection typically costs between $150 and $400 across commercial properties. This non-invasive detection uses a high-res camera to locate blockages in real time.
